Transaction fa63ec902bf0496765dac31bc62adc8a81963408fe5270ea1f1a42575152fe3e

3 Input
2 Outputs
  • fa63ec902bf0496765dac31bc62adc8a81963408fe5270ea1f1a42575152fe3e:0
  • value  20000000
    address  1BtSE7AXX5RuRRcnbhiM3qBwMhEYwxqBsm
  • fa63ec902bf0496765dac31bc62adc8a81963408fe5270ea1f1a42575152fe3e:1
  • value  21806629
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f